Sarah Jane Cubbage 1948 - 2010

Sarah Jane Cubbage of Albuquerque, Bernalillo County, NM was born on May 4, 1948, and died at age 62 years old on December 21, 2010. Sarah Cubbage was buried at Santa Fe National Cemetery Section 8 Site 419 501 North Guadalupe Street, in Santa Fe.
